Junior Full Stack Developer (Remote)


New York
Westbury, New York

Our Client is looking for a Senior Full Stack Developer to join their growing team. The successful candidate will play an important role in our client's commitment to continuous improvement. In order to provide our internal and external members with quality service, the candidate will strive to make error-free work a reality and shall display courtesy and cooperation with employees and management. They must have technical expertise in all facets of Application Development, Maintenance and utilities on the Windows Operating System (both on the Client and the Server Side) including Database Application Development. This would include the API development and Integration as well as Application development in Python and/or C#. Each IT employee is expected to meet and/or exceed security protocol requirements to protect from cyber threats and member’s data and all computer equipment at all times. 

Whats in it for you? 

  • Competitive compensation, $75,000/Year 
  • Paid training 
  • Fully Remote oppurtunity
  • Open communication and an amazingly positive staff 
  • Managers who value input from their employees 
  • A friendly, inviting work environment 
  • Work that feels like a second home with family events 
  • Leaders who are involved, transparent and coach you 
  • Professional development and a perfect atmosphere for learning 
  • Fun social activities to nurture creativity and teamwork 
  • Great benefits – Medical, Dental, 401k, pension, tuition reimbursement and more – We have you covered 
  • School Loan Repayment & Gym Reimbursement  
  • Lots of growth and advancement potential 

What you will be doing:  

  • Build, consume, document and integrate of APIs in a development, test and production environment supporting the Credit Union’s Software Platform. Development of RESTful API’s in Python Flask and / Or Node JS Express is required. 
  • Develop web applications for internal IT Services 
  • Develop functional databases, applications, and servers to support websites on the back end 
  • Optimization of the application for maximum speed and scalability 
  • Review designs created by designers; ask any necessary clarifying questions before starting on work 
  • Lead and manage end-to end life cycle for the production of software and applications; through a project conception to finished product 
  • Work with IT Management to develop programming templates and standards consistent with industry best practice 
  • Collaborate with appropriate stakeholders (e.g. IT staff, department managers, end users) to gather requirements, develop specifications, author, debug, test and document program code 

What we need from you: 

  • 3-5 Years of experience in Analysis, Design, Development, Management, and Implementation of various standalone and client - server architecture-based enterprise application software (Banking Preferred) 
  • Extensive knowledge in Python, PHP, PLSQL, SQL Server. 
  • Experience with Design, code, debug operations, reporting, data analysis and web applications utilizing Python. 
  • Worked with MVW frameworks like Django, Angular JS, HTML, CSS, XML, Java Script, jQuery, JSON and Node.js. 
  • Involvement in building frameworks and automating complex workflows using Python for Test Automation. 
  • Experience in writing REST APIs in Python for large-scale applications. Experience with Mulesoft or KONG preferred 
  • Excellent working Experience in Agile (SCRUM) using TFS and Waterfall methodologies with high quality deliverables delivered on-time. 
  • Write Python modules to extract/load data from the SQL based source databases. 
  • Good Command of web services with protocols SOAP, REST. 
  • Must have used PyUnit, the Python unit test framework, for all Python applications. 
  • Good working experience in using version control systems CVS, SVN, Git, and GitHub. 
  • Proficient in developing web applications using PHP, MYSQL, AWS, Flask, Jinja, HTML, XML, JSON, CSS, Java Script & AJAX. 
  • Experience in working with Python ORM Libraries including Django ORM. 
  • Skilled in testing tools like JIRA. 
  • Experienced in working with various Python IDEs using PyCharm, Spyder, NetBeans, PyStudio, PyScripter, Eric, Wing IDE and PyDev. 
  • Adept at automating repetitive work through Python. 
  • Knowledgeable in Microsoft.NET, C#, PLSQL/T-SQL coding, and program debugging. 

#spcorp

Skip to the main content